Interpolate(verb)

Insert (something) between fixed points; estimate an unknown value within a range using known values. (??? ??? ??????)
Synonyms: Insert, Interject, Introduce, Estimate
Antonyms: Remove, Delete, Extract, Omit
Example: The editor interpolated a clarifying sentence between the two paragraphs.
